APH1A Antibody

Background

APH1A Antibody. This antibody is expected to recognize both reported isoforms (NP_001071096.1 and NP_057106.2).

Additional Names

APH1A, anterior pharynx defective 1 homolog A (C. elegans), 6530402N02Rik, APH-1A, CGI-78, anterior pharynx defective 1 homolog A

APH1A Antibody

Description

Left: Western blot analysis of APH1A in human cerebral cortex lysate (35μg protein in RIPA buffer) using APH1A antibody (0.05μg/mL).

Source

APH1A antibody was raised against a synthetic peptide of APH1A.

Purification

APH1A antibody was purified from goat serum by ammonium sulphate precipitation followed by antigen affinity chromatography using the immunizing peptide.

Clonality / Clone

This is a polyclonal antibody.

Host

APH1A antibody was raised in goat.

Please use anti-goat secondary antibodies.

Application

Peptide ELISA: Antibody detection limit dilution 1:128,000. Western Blot: Approx 26kDa band observed in human brain (cerebral cortex) lysates (calculated MW of 26.8kDa according to NP_057106.2). Recommended concentration: 0.05-0.1μg/ml.

Tested Application

E, WB

Buffer

APH1A antibody is supplied as 0.1mg of purified antibody, 0.5 mg/ml in Tris saline, 0.02% sodium azide, pH7.3 with 0.5% bovine serum albumin.

Blocking Peptide

Cat. No. 45-262P - APH1A Peptide

Storage

Aliquot and store at -20°C. Minimize freezing and thawing.

Species Reactivity

H, M, R

Protein Accession Number

NP_001071096.1, NP_057106.2
